INSURANCE LITERACY DRIVE: NAICOM, SDGs SYNERGY INITIATIVE MOVE TO PROMOTE INSURANCE LITERACY.

 

The National Insurance Commission (NAICOM) and the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) Synergy Initiative are set to deepen collaboration aimed at strengthening youth participation in sustainable development while promoting public awareness of insurance as a tool for resilience and protection.

 

During a courtesy visit to NAICOM headquarters, the Executive Director of the Initiative, Usman Alhaji Lawan, presented a proposal for the Commission’s support in an upcoming youth summit.

 

The summit, being organized in partnership with the National Youth Assembly of Nigeria (NYAN) and supported by the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), seeks to mobilize Nigerian youths in advancing the SDGs and highlight their role in sustainable national growth.

 

Lawan underscored the need to sensitize young Nigerians on the importance of insurance, noting that plans were also underway to foster collaborations between Nigerian youths and the Brazilian Embassy on SDG-related projects.

 

Welcoming the delegation, NAICOM’s Deputy Commissioner for Insurance, Finance and Administration, Ekerete Ola Gam-Ikon, commended the Initiative’s efforts and reaffirmed the Commission’s commitment to youth-focused outreach. He pointed out that NAICOM is already working with the Federal Ministry of Youth to train one million young people in insurance literacy and capacity building.

 

With the renewed partnership, stakeholders say the initiative will not only boost insurance literacy among young Nigerians but also strengthen their role as key drivers in achieving the Sustainable Development Goals.
